The Good

  • Basic Strategy: Utilizing a basic strategy chart can reduce the house edge to as low as 0.5%. This strategy involves making decisions based on mathematical probabilities, guiding players on when to hit, stand, double down, or split.
  • Card Counting: When done correctly, this technique can provide a significant advantage. Card counters can determine when the deck is favorable by keeping track of high and low cards. This approach can increase the player’s edge to 1% to 2%.
  • Bankroll Management: Setting a budget and adhering to it is crucial. Players should avoid wagering more than 5% of their total bankroll on a single hand.

The Bad

  • Progressive Betting Systems: Systems like Martingale or Fibonacci can seem appealing, but they often lead to significant losses. These methods require a large bankroll and can result in substantial dips during losing streaks.
  • Overconfidence: Many players mistakenly believe they can beat the game with luck alone. This mindset can lead to reckless betting and poor decision-making.
  • Ignoring Table Rules: Different tables have varying rules that affect the game’s RTP. For instance, tables that pay 6:5 for blackjack significantly increase the house edge compared to those that pay 3:2.

The Ugly

Some strategies and practices can be detrimental to a player’s success:

  • Taking Insurance: This bet, offered when the dealer shows an Ace, typically has a higher house edge of around 7.4%, making it a poor choice for most players.
  • Chasing Losses: This behavior can lead to financial troubles, as players may increase their bets in an attempt to recover losses.
